Paulistão A2 returns this Tuesday. See the predictions of the 5th round


After 40 days of stoppage, the second division has a marathon scheduled for the dispute of the next three rounds.


Finally, the Paulista Football Federation and the participating clubs in the Serie A2 of Paulistão reached an agreement for the return of the competition. In addition to stricter protocols for Covid-19 testing, all matches will be played after 8 pm, which will take some teams out of their stadiums.


Rio Claro, Água Santa, Monte Azul and Juventus will look for other places to send their games, since their stadiums have no lighting. The request of the clubs to end the competition in May, will force the dispute of a marathon of games to finish the classification phase, there are eleven matches left, and the final phase, will be four games until the definition of the two teams that go up to the A1 and two more games in the title decision.


By planning the table, we have 16 games in the next 40 days, an average of one game every 2.5 days. Let there be breath and cast for the teams!

The first three finishes continue with 100% success and the lantern has not yet won in the competition.


According to the regulation, the first eight placed advance to the knockout at the end of the 15 rounds of the qualifying phase and the two worst are relegated to the A3 Series.
